Output feca32f1df4516a288316b883a2c7b7005b75a71346ebebb78b017c28284c9d3:1

value
25596167
script pubkey
OP_0 OP_PUSHBYTES_32 c21eb8308f47d82dc41f006c6f23a461bf3841087832a971d808997fea6eccf0
address
bc1qcg0tsvy0glvzm3qlqpkx7gayvxlnssgg0qe2juwcpzvhl6nwencq7u2qde
transaction
feca32f1df4516a288316b883a2c7b7005b75a71346ebebb78b017c28284c9d3